What does the low-power mode enabled do?
This is meant to be to show the time&date&weather when the device is pulled out the pocket without waking up the device with the power button.
You can try it following these steps:
- lock the screen with the power button
- cover the proximity sensor at the top for a few seconds
- uncover the sensor
- The clock should appear in blue for a short time.
(I am not sure how reliably this works on newer Sailfish versions. It worked well on older releases but Jolla might change this because on some Sony models there is a problem with the proximity sensor when the device is in a deep-sleep and they couldn't fix that. Then they decided to switch this off when a device goes to deep-sleep. What I am not sure is whether they did this for all devices or just for Sony devices.)
No, these don't need to reapplied after reboots.
